About  Relay Sockets

Products in this category belong to the family of interconnect devices designed to create a semi-permanent connection between the wiring in a system and a switching device, such as an electromechanical relay. These devices are specifically intended to facilitate easier service or replacement of the switching device during the system's operational lifespan. By using these interconnect devices, the time, effort, and level of skill required to replace worn or damaged components can be significantly reduced if the need for service arises. The purpose of these interconnect devices is to act as an interface between the wiring system and the switching device. They provide a reliable and secure connection that allows for efficient and convenient replacement or repair of the switching device without having to disassemble or reconfigure the entire wiring system. This saves valuable time and effort, particularly in complex systems where multiple connections are involved. The use of these interconnect devices offers several benefits. First and foremost, it simplifies the process of replacing or servicing the switching device. Rather than having to remove and reconnect individual wires, the interconnect device enables a quick and straightforward disconnection and reconnection of the switching device. This reduces the risk of errors and damage to the wiring system during maintenance procedures. Additionally, these interconnect devices help standardize the system's wiring connections, making it easier to ensure compatibility and consistency when replacing or upgrading switching devices. This standardization reduces the likelihood of errors and improves overall system reliability. These interconnect devices are commonly used in various industries and applications where electromechanical relays or other switch devices are employed. They find particular utility in systems that require regular maintenance or have a high likelihood of component replacement due to wear and tear or upgrades.
